The correct tyre size for your Nissan X-Trail can be found on the sticker located on the driver's side doorjamb or in your owner's manual. Common sizes include 225/65 R17, 225/60 R18, 225/55 R19 (2014–2020), and 235/65 R17, 235/60 R18, 235/55 R19, 255/45 R20 (2021–2024). Always verify the specific Nissan X-Trail tyre size for your vehicle's year and trim to ensure proper fit, performance, and safety.

Most Common Tyre Size For The Peugeot 208
The most common tyre sizes for the Peugeot 208 typically include:
- 185/65 R15: Common on entry-level trims, providing a comfortable and efficient ride.
- 195/55 R16: The standard fitment for Allure and mid-range models.
- 205/45 R17: Found on GT and sportier versions for enhanced cornering stability.
Always check your vehicle’s tyre placard (located on the driver’s side doorjamb) or owner's manual to ensure the correct Peugeot 208 tyre size for your specific trim level. For the electric e-208, using the correct specification is vital to maintain battery range and handle the instant torque of the electric motor.
Tyre Size Guide By Year
| Year Range | Trim / Version | Front Size | Rear Size |
| 2012 - 2019 | 1.0 VTi / Access | 185/65 R15 | 185/65 R15 |
| 2012 - 2019 | 1.2 VTi / 1.6 BlueHDi | 195/55 R16 | 195/55 R16 |
| 2019 - 2026 | 1.2 PureTech / Allure | 195/55 R16 | 195/55 R16 |
| 2019 - 2026 | e-208 (Electric) | 195/55 R16 | 195/55 R16 |
| 2019 - 2026 | GT / GT Pack | 205/45 R17 | 205/45 R17 |

The recommended tyre pressure for your Nissan X-Trail is typically found on a sticker located on the driver's side doorjamb or in your owner's manual. Maintaining the correct tyre pressure is crucial for optimal handling, fuel efficiency, and tyre life.
